Каковы операторы цикла, представленные в блок-схеме карточки № 12, и как составить программу для получения результата ее выполнения?
Информатика Колледж Циклы и алгоритмы операторы цикла блок-схема карточка 12 программа получение результата информатика Новый
В блок-схеме карточки № 12 могут быть представлены различные операторы цикла, такие как "while", "for" и "do while". Каждый из этих операторов выполняет свою задачу, позволяя повторять выполнение определенного блока кода, пока выполняется заданное условие. Давайте рассмотрим каждый из них более подробно.
Операторы цикла:
Теперь давайте рассмотрим, как составить программу для получения результата выполнения цикла. Предположим, что в блок-схеме описан цикл, который суммирует числа от 1 до N. Мы можем использовать любой из вышеупомянутых операторов цикла. Рассмотрим пример на языке Python с использованием цикла for:
N = int(input("Введите число N: ")) # Запрашиваем у пользователя число N sum = 0 # Инициализируем переменную для хранения суммы for i in range(1, N + 1): # Цикл от 1 до N sum += i # Добавляем текущее значение i к сумме print("Сумма чисел от 1 до", N, "равна", sum) # Выводим результат
В этом примере мы:
Таким образом, мы можем использовать различные операторы цикла для реализации одной и той же задачи, и выбор зависит от конкретных условий задачи.